Zenless Zone Zero Is A Stylish New ARPG From Genshin Impact Developer

The team behind Genshin Impact just revealed a brand new ARPG and announced beta sign ups for Zenless Zone Zero.

While the HoYoverse continues to conquer the gaming market with massive mobile titles Genshin Impact and Honkai Impact Third, it seems that HoYoverse isn’t done yet. Wafter teasing Zenless Zone Zero lately, we now know a ton more detail about what to expect when the latest title from this bunch of Otakus arrives.

HoYoverse unveiled a new stylized urbanite ARPG last night, inviting players to jump into a world ruled by breaks in reality and twin personas. Moving away from Teyvat and its high fantasy lore, Zenless Zone Zero is set in the city of New Eridu. This seemingly up to date metropolis comes with its own set of problems. Moring traffic aside, it exists in the wake of its own apocalypse where incursions in reality threaten the last bastion of human civilization. HoYoverse describes these Hollows as a bubble that grow out of thin air, creating disordered dimensions where mysterious monsters dubbed the “Ethereal” roam.Players picking up the latest from HoYoverse will find themselves in the role of a “Proxy” — a special professional who guides people in their exploration of Hollows. A great many people want to enter the Hollows for their own various reasons. Whether it’s for profit, sentiment, or just curiosity, players will help them explore the Hollows, battle their enemies, or to achieve their goals.

An official website is already available to find out more about New Eridu and HoYoverse has also dropped a brand new gameplay trailer, which you can see above. From what we can gather, this is looking like it will be an instance based ARPG with plenty of free form combat and an anime style that doesn’t feel too far from Soulworker and other fully 3D adventures.
